Agency Information
Name: Sibling Class Schneck Medical Center
Category: Health
Purpose: The Sibling Class at Schneck helps young children better understand what to expect when a brother or sister joins the family. This class is designed for children age 3 through 9 to attend with their parents to prepare for the transition ahead.
Additional Information
Address: Schneck Medical Center, 411 W. Tipton Street, Seymour, Indiana 47274
Phone: 812-524-3373
Website: http://www.schneckmed.org/connect/events/pregnancy-classes/sibling-class/
Classes meet one Tuesday of every other month from 6:30 p.m. to 8 p.m. in Classroom 5 (5th floor of SMC within the Family Life Center). Call 524-3373 for more information. You can call or register online at the website above. Please register one week prior to class.
Please call ahead to check on meeting times.
